    We have a gas log splitter too. I like gas because we can take it where ever we want to. If you had an electric splitter you are stuck splitting where there is electricity. We actually take our splitter right into the woods with us. Every piece of wood is split prior to us bringing it home.

    I agree that each has its place. I went with the electric as I have the wood delivered to my home. With the small size of the electric I can tip it on its legs and store in a corner of the garage.
    Also I only spent $400 delivered.
